Commit graph

  • 5794a223ce view: associate launch contexts with views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 9d78ede905 launcher: rename pid_workspace to launcher_ctx Ronan Pigott 2022-11-16 15:50:34 -07:00
  • cb13b9d628 launcher: use xdga tokens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 69abc41d25 launcher: track workspaces by node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 16b391db48 node: prettify node type names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 25f559dcde root: move the workspace matching code to its own file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 52166bc1f5 build: drop intermediate libraries for protocols Simon Ser 2022-11-25 10:51:20 +01:00
  • 2a6bcc6738 build: drop "server" from target name for protocol code Simon Ser 2022-11-25 10:48:07 +01:00
  • 61e4e65ea6 build: unify server & client protocol generation Simon Ser 2022-11-25 10:46:53 +01:00
  • ceece55850 build: drop wayland-scanner fallback Simon Ser 2022-11-25 10:46:00 +01:00
  • 9f4229827f Use shm_open instead of mkstemp Manuel Stoeckl 2022-11-24 17:56:01 -05:00
  • 68b4ed3a4a output: set damage ring bounds to pixel values Kirill Primak 2022-11-12 12:58:48 +03:00
  • 5a2563b1a4 workspace_create: Don't allow NULL name Alexander Orzechowski 2022-07-09 14:05:04 -04:00
  • 94b69acf0d swaybar: Make hotspots block bar release bindings Joan Bruguera 2021-09-18 22:21:22 +02:00
  • 53f9dbd424 swaybar: Prioritize hotspot events to bar bindings Joan Bruguera 2021-09-04 06:44:56 +02:00
  • 28fda4c0d3 launcher: export X startup ids and use them for workspace matching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 30ad4dc4a5 launcher: export xdga tokens and use them for workspace matching Ronan Pigott 2022-11-18 20:05:24 -07:00
  • bdeb9f9565 launcher: fudge the interface a bit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 66568508c0 launcher: initialize launcher_ctxs once on startup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 864b3a9a18 view: associate launch contexts with views Ronan Pigott 2022-11-16 15:50:34 -07:00
  • d75c9f9722 launcher: rename pid_workspace to launcher_ctx Ronan Pigott 2022-11-16 15:50:34 -07:00
  • bd66f4943d launcher: use xdga tokens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 3b49f2782e launcher: track workspaces by node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 1c4b94ae3c node: prettify node type names Ronan Pigott 2022-11-16 15:50:34 -07:00
  • eb5021ef99 root: move the workspace matching code to its own file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 3cde99d85e shortcuts_inhibitor: default to disabled Ronan Pigott 2022-11-25 20:05:47 -07:00
  • f386339816 launcher: export X startup ids and use them for workspace matching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 3eb359571d launcher: export xdga tokens and use them for workspace matching Ronan Pigott 2022-11-18 20:05:24 -07:00
  • 33d035262f launcher: fudge the interface a bit Ronan Pigott 2022-11-16 15:50:34 -07:00
  • be8581ad77 launcher: initialize launcher_ctxs once on startup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 60c8b8a194 view: associate launch contexts with views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 61c3167f0d launcher: rename pid_workspace to launcher_ctx Ronan Pigott 2022-11-16 15:50:34 -07:00
  • b4ea5d68f3 launcher: use xdga tokens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 7a087a0c54 launcher: track workspaces by node Ronan Pigott 2022-11-16 15:50:34 -07:00
  • c03962dbdd node: prettify node type names Ronan Pigott 2022-11-16 15:50:34 -07:00
  • 8a127981da root: move the workspace matching code to its own file Ronan Pigott 2022-11-16 15:50:34 -07:00
  • af8a5a8918 build: drop intermediate libraries for protocols Simon Ser 2022-11-25 10:51:20 +01:00
  • e5475d9310 build: drop "server" from target name for protocol code Simon Ser 2022-11-25 10:48:07 +01:00
  • 5be5a038da build: unify server & client protocol generation Simon Ser 2022-11-25 10:46:53 +01:00
  • 366f6ef3d3 build: drop wayland-scanner fallback Simon Ser 2022-11-25 10:46:00 +01:00
  • e2bc8866f4 Use shm_open instead of mkstemp Manuel Stoeckl 2022-11-24 17:56:01 -05:00
  • 9435220d89 Use shm_open instead of mkstemp Manuel Stoeckl 2022-11-24 17:56:01 -05:00
  • fab91af9b9 updated default config Will McKinnon 2022-11-24 00:04:56 -05:00
  • cf5a188aa9
    feat: rounded_corners support smart_gaps (#62) William McKinnon 2022-11-23 23:59:47 -05:00
  • 6951b8e493
    render refactor: implement decoration_data struct (#61) William McKinnon 2022-11-23 23:37:35 -05:00
  • d27c346b9e
    Added flake support for wlroots subproject (#60) Gokul Swaminathan 2022-11-22 11:24:38 -08:00
  • 46378d4b69 cleanup: removed sway sourcehut build files Will McKinnon 2022-11-19 02:49:54 -05:00
  • 8339a07f45 fix: delete all shaders on fx_renderer create failure Will McKinnon 2022-11-18 20:00:52 -05:00
  • 5e066dfc3c fix: saturation applies to popups Will McKinnon 2022-11-18 01:22:13 -05:00
  • 191e3b5d26 Improved copr install testing (#55) Erik Reider 2022-11-16 17:25:32 +01:00
  • 6a2fb63cd1 docs: Clarify how to use a custom XKB symbol file. Mark Stosberg 2022-11-16 13:58:41 -05:00
  • 0cd40fed13
    Fix Nix Flake (#50) Gokul Swaminathan 2022-11-16 08:24:00 -08:00
  • fa6164f8fb
    Improve Nix Flake (#48) Gokul Swaminathan 2022-11-15 19:47:04 -08:00
  • 7623292734 Update for wlroots!3814 Simon Ser 2022-11-03 18:39:14 +01:00
  • 3ca11f7652 Update for wlroots!3814 Simon Ser 2022-11-03 18:39:14 +01:00
  • 717e9ef581 ipc: add view content type Simon Ser 2022-10-04 09:46:47 +02:00
  • 907ca48a61 Listen to the output request_state event Simon Ser 2021-01-28 16:19:15 +01:00
  • e58247e100 Listen to the output request_state event Simon Ser 2021-01-28 16:19:15 +01:00
  • 7cd87b5752 ipc: add view content type Simon Ser 2022-10-04 09:46:47 +02:00
  • 024c3e4428 input/seat: locally compute drag icon offset Simon Ser 2022-11-15 14:48:28 +01:00
  • b56c7483f9 input/seat: locally compute drag icon offset Simon Ser 2022-11-15 14:48:28 +01:00
  • 546f56f873
    AUR publish actions: Remove checkingout of tag (#42) Erik Reider 2022-11-15 08:51:08 +01:00
  • ffaab52752 Updated build scripts Erik Reider 2022-11-14 17:12:43 +01:00
  • e1be46875d sway/server: specify wlr-layer-shell version on creation Simon Zeni 2022-11-14 09:59:58 -05:00
  • 7aa1b222dd sway/server: specify wlr-layer-shell version on creation Simon Zeni 2022-11-14 09:59:58 -05:00
  • b543fd4a64 Fixed PKGBUILD stable not downloading, building and packaging Erik Reider 2022-11-14 09:37:09 +01:00
  • 6c1a3ec2f7 build: set version to 0.1 Will McKinnon 2022-11-13 14:42:14 -05:00
  • 7990b32dd2
    Add PKGBUILD stable and -git, AUR publish and Arch build GitHub Actions (#31) Erik Reider 2022-11-13 15:58:24 +01:00
  • c82adeb7c0
    Add EGL as sway dependency (#33) Erik Reider 2022-11-12 15:04:29 +01:00
  • 85005b52fe output: set damage ring bounds to pixel values Kirill Primak 2022-11-12 12:58:48 +03:00
  • 45358f518a output: set damage ring bounds to pixel values Kirill Primak 2022-11-12 12:58:48 +03:00
  • 6ef904a960 style: shader style fixes Will McKinnon 2022-11-11 21:28:32 -05:00
  • 1a9f17054d feat: added support for external textures Will McKinnon 2022-11-11 21:21:51 -05:00
  • 6ca742d4f2 feat: render tiling move indicator with round corners Will McKinnon 2022-11-11 20:05:05 -05:00
  • 1881b01d3f
    Per application color saturation support (#21) Erik Reider 2022-11-12 01:38:09 +01:00
  • 34933bb843 workspace_create: Don't allow NULL name Alexander Orzechowski 2022-07-09 14:05:04 -04:00
  • b2e3629ecb workspace_create: Don't allow NULL name Alexander Orzechowski 2022-07-09 14:05:04 -04:00
  • fdde67405e build: bump wlroots dependency to 0.17.0 Joe Kappus 2022-11-11 14:59:20 -05:00
  • 0143c7ade8 ci: checkout wlroots 0.16.0 Simon Ser 2022-11-11 22:30:10 +01:00
  • 5a10515fd8
    build: bump wlroots dependency to 0.17.0 Joe Kappus 2022-11-11 14:59:20 -05:00
  • 5c239eaac5 container_get_siblings: handle NULL workspace Baltazár Radics 2022-08-02 18:32:22 +02:00
  • d945c8f519 lock: fix crash on output destroy Simon Ser 2022-11-10 11:24:48 +01:00
  • 853fb79da9 lock: fix crash on output destroy Simon Ser 2022-11-10 11:24:48 +01:00
  • 7862fa670e
    Use wlr_damage_ring Kirill Primak 2022-11-11 18:29:04 +03:00
  • 66a1c7f76c chore: use wlr_damage_ring Kirill Primak 2022-11-08 20:35:21 +03:00
  • 8c907a0bcb doc: updated README with contribution info Will McKinnon 2022-11-11 01:56:30 -05:00
  • 1930bd0d71
    feat: add round titlebars (#26) William McKinnon 2022-11-11 01:19:02 -05:00
  • 5b99f2b6c3
    Merge cb4205185c into dcd2076f38 Kirill Primak 2022-11-10 13:02:06 -08:00
  • dcd2076f38 Use wl_signal_emit_mutable() Simon Ser 2022-11-10 14:35:14 +01:00
  • 19d47989c4 Use wl_signal_emit_mutable() Simon Ser 2022-11-10 14:35:14 +01:00
  • 9ee7fa61af style: moved corner radius scaling out of fx call Will McKinnon 2022-11-10 02:16:15 -05:00
  • 26271ef865 refactor: move shaders to individual files Will McKinnon 2022-11-10 01:32:28 -05:00
  • 6c3b35701d ci: install hwdata Kirill Primak 2022-11-09 11:07:20 +03:00
  • 82c08d8942 ci: install hwdata Kirill Primak 2022-11-09 11:07:20 +03:00
  • cb4205185c Add wp-fractional-scale-v1 support Kirill Primak 2022-11-07 20:40:00 +03:00
  • f167200022 chore: chase wlroots fractional coords update Kirill Primak 2022-11-07 20:21:38 +03:00
  • 25f1fc6c9c scene_graph: port wlr_forgein_toplevel_management output enter/leave events Alexander Orzechowski 2022-08-07 20:16:08 -04:00
  • b581b30609 remove damage debug options Alexander Orzechowski 2022-04-30 17:09:44 -04:00
  • 26e0ccc362 Fix SIGSEGV on surface destroy Alexander Orzechowski 2022-03-18 08:42:30 -04:00
  • d1417b8a13 output: destroy output after ensuring it is disabled Alexander Orzechowski 2022-02-22 00:50:18 -05:00